Bail refers to the monetary amount set by the court that allows a defendant to be released from custody while awaiting test. In comparison, a bond is an economic warranty given by a bond bondsman, that bills a non-refundable cost, typically around 10% of the total Bail quantity, to safeguard the launch of the accused.
Bail amounts can differ significantly based on factors such as the nature of the charges, the offender's criminal background, and the viewed flight risk (craven bail bonds troy ohio). It is very important to note that Bail is not a type of punishment; instead, it offers as a system to support the principle of assumed virtue up until tested guilty
Comprehending the differences in between Bail and bond can aid offenders and their family members in making notified decisions regarding their release alternatives. Court Appearances and Obligations

Court looks are a vital element of the bail bond procedure, as they work as a suggestion of the offender's commitments following their launch. Upon uploading Bail, accuseds need to comply with the terms stated by the court, which typically consist of attending all arranged hearings and tests. Failing to appear can cause extreme effects, consisting of the forfeit of the Bail quantity and the issuance of a bench warrant for apprehension.
The legal system anticipates defendants to take their commitments seriously, as their existence is important for the judicial procedure. Each court look allows the court to examine the situation's progress and make certain that the accused is abiding by legal needs. Moreover, constant presence shows the defendant's dedication to fixing their lawful problems, which might positively affect the court's assumption.
Accuseds are also motivated to remain in communication with their bail bond representative, as the agent can give assistance and suggestions about upcoming court days.
